— 04 | SOCIAL ACTIVITIES ACTIVITIES Founded in 1873, the Compagnie Générale de Naviga- tion (CGN) has the largest fleet of “Belle Epoque” boats in Europe, with eight of its twenty boats equipped with paddle wheels. From seminars or exhibitions to gala meals cooked by prestigious chefs and caterers, CGN boats adapt to each event. Capacity up to 1,400 people.
